Derek Chauvin, a veteran of the Minneapolis Police Department, faces murder and manslaughter charges.

Terrence Floyd brother of George Floyd spoke with emotion during a prayer service at Greater Friendship Missionary Church yesterday Image: Jerry Holt via PA Images Terrence Floyd brother of George Floyd spoke with emotion during a prayer service at Greater Friendship Missionary Church yesterday Image: Jerry Holt via PA Images Updated 16 minutes ago

Prosecutor Jerry Blackwell told jurors that Chauvin “didn’t let up, he didn’t get up” even after Floyd said 27 times that he could not breathe and went motionless. We know that if George Floyd was a white American citizen, and he suffered this painful, tortuous death with a police officer’s knee on his neck, nobody, nobody, would be saying this is a hard case. The trial is expected to last about four weeks at the courthouse in downtown Minneapolis.

For the unintentional second-degree murder charge, prosecutors have to prove Chauvin’s conduct was a “substantial causal factor” in Floyd’s death, and that Chauvin was committing felony assault at the time.
